What's a red inflamed circle on my dog's belly and is it contagious?
This lesion could indicate a local bacteria infection, possibly ringworm, an insect bite, or just an area of rotation of unknown cause. You could continue to monitor if you feel comfortable and if it does not go away within a few days I would reconsider seeing your veterinarian to ensure it's nothing contagious like ringworm. However if it starts to grow, bleed, become raised, or seems painful it should be seen sooner.
In the meantime you could consider cleaning it with a very mild soap and warm water and keeping it clean and dry during the day. As there is a possibility it could be ringworm wash your hands thoroughly after handling the site.
